Cowichan Lake
One of Vancouver Island's premier large freshwater lakes offering wild rainbow and cutthroat action year-round.

Cowichan Lake at a glance
- Region
- Region 1 - Vancouver Island
- Management unit
- MU 1-5
- Elevation
- 164 m
- Maximum depth
- 152 m
- Surface area
- 6204.0 ha
- Trout strain
- Wild Coastal Cutthroat & Rainbow Trout
- Typical size
- 2 to 5 lbs (Quality Trout)
- Stocking
- Wild self-sustaining fishery
- Boat launch
- Concrete Ramp (Trailer Friendly)
- Motor rules
- 🚤 Gas & Electric Motors Permitted
- Ice fishing
- Open, confirmed
When to fish it
- March - June
- September - November
Getting there
Lake Cowichan townsite, multiple public concrete boat ramps, marinas, provincial parks.
Coordinates: 48.8747, -124.2597
Regulations
Single barbless hook, bait ban in tributaries, check synopsis for wild trout quotas.
